Dynamics of simplified HPT model in relation to 24h TSH profiles

Agnieszka BartłomiejczykBeata Jackowska-Zduniak — 2018

Mathematica Applicanda

We propose a simplified mathematical model of the hypothalamus-pituitary-thyroid (HPT) axis in an endocrine system. The considered model is a modification of the model proposed by Mukhopadhyay in [9]. Our system of delay differential equations reconstructs the HPT-axis in relation to 24h profiles of human in physiological conditions.
